Renewable energy

Hydroelectric power, together with nuclear power forms the basis of the Swedish electricity system. The operation does not cause any carbon dioxide emissions and the water goes back into the river after leaving the turbine. 100% of the electricity we purchase for our facilities in Malmö and Stockholm come from hydroelectric power.

Offsetting our carbon footprint

We offset all our business travel by car and air. Carbon offsetting means that greenhouse gas emissions caused by a company’s travel are compensated by the fact that carbon dioxide is reduced somewhere else in the world. The Vi Agroforestry project for climate compensation called “Trees give Life” and is carried out in the Cager region of Western Tanzania, where sustainable farming methods are developed for trees and crops. Every tree that is planted is vital. The trees improve the climate and that gives people the hope for a better life.

Plan International 

By being a sponsor we support Plan Internationals work with the most vulnerable and excluded children, especially girls, with particular focus on gender equality. Plan International wants girls and boys to have the same opportunities in life. They are active in over 70 countries. Last year Plan International’s work reached over 50 million children.

The Foundation - FTS Säkra Varje Unge

The foundation FTS Säkra Varje Unge is a non-profit organization with the aim of preventing sexual abuse of children and grooming through preventive work and free education for all adults, children and young people throughout Sweden. The foundation is politically and religiously independent and is based on the UN Convention on the Rights of the Child, the Convention on the Rights of the Child.

The Foundation works to prevent sexual exploitation of children through information, seminars and educational materials. Generation PEP

We support Generation Pep’s vision – that all children and youngsters should have the opportunity and desire to live an active and healthy life. Today, only three out of ten youngsters get the recommended amount of physical activity of 60 minutes a day and only one in ten eat enough vegetables, fruits and berries.
